ec/fini: Fix race between xlator cleanup and on going async fop
Problem: While we process a cleanup, there is a chance for a race between async operations, for example ec_launch_replace_heal. So this can lead to invalid mem access. Solution: Just like we track on going heal fops, we can also track fops like ec_launch_replace_heal, so that we can decide when to send a PARENT_DOWN request.
